The Tank Assembly problem

Yesterday we noticed a gasoline smell surrounding our 2006 Sedona van. Today, the smell was noticeably stronger. The van was taken to the kia dealer who found a hole in the fuel tank. The tank is not considered defective, and we are paying for a replacement.   Read details...
